WebMay 31, 2024 · Stretched clusters provide redundancy and failure protection across data centers in two geographical locations. Fault domains provide protection from rack-level failures within the same site. Each site in a stretched cluster resides in a separate fault domain. Open the Failover Cluster … WebYou could use asymmetric storage when you create a cluster with 4 nodes spread over 2 locations. Not all the nodes in the cluster can access all available storage in the cluster, the cluster nodes in location A have a different SAN connected than the node in location B.

WebFeb 20, 2024 · StarWind HA performs in active-active mode, thus it is a best practice to use identical hardware for all the nodes participating in an HA storage cluster. Rarely, one HA node can have faster storage to improve read performance. In this case, ALUA (Asymmetric Logical Unit Access) is configured to achieve the optimal performance.
